Understanding Delayed Pain Post-Accident


It’s not unusual for individuals involved in minor collisions to walk away feeling perfectly fine, only to develop symptoms days or even weeks later. This delayed onset of pain is more common than you might think. In fact, the adrenaline and stress associated with an accident can mask underlying injuries in the initial hours after the incident. 


So why do injuries crop up later? Soft tissue injuries, such as whiplash, strains, or even small joint dislocations, often take time to fully manifest. If ignored, these “minor” symptoms can lead to chronic pain or more severe health issues down the road.

Why Minor Symptoms Can Have Major Consequences


A trending question many patients ask is: “How long after a car accident can pain start?” In many cases, symptoms can emerge 24 to 72 hours—or even longer—after the accident. While it may be tempting to wait and see, ignoring these signals can hinder your recovery. Untreated injuries may lead to:


  • Chronic pain syndromes
  • Reduced mobility or range of motion
  • Persistent headaches and migraines
  • Complications with insurance claims if injuries are not documented early.
